Is this a factory 10" barrel? It has internal threads at the muzzle end (internal choke)
and holes at 11 & 1 o'clock.. Anyone know if this came this way? Hot shot?

Yep, it's a factory Bull 357 mag hot-shot barrel. It's set up to be used with an internal choke that has five lands and grooves. the tool for inserting and removing is referred to as a "key", somewhat similar to the key used with the 45/44 chokes. Naturally they shipped with the choke and key, if both are missing, it "didn't come that way". There was an octagon version that used an external choke. There is a 44 version as well, with a vent rib, no ports. The 357 hot-shot came out well after both the 45-410 and 44 H-S. When they stopped making the 45-410 it was called 45Colt w/choke. It was resurrected after a few years hiatus and it's the only one of the three still in production. The 357 had the shortest time in production.

Do the porting holes actually help keep her in check?
I assume the accuracy with the 357 is still not so great...

With the choke in, the ports are effectively closed off. With it out and shooting single projectile ammunition, it *may* help some. Accuracy with the 357 and 44 H-S's isn't too awfully bad, they do have some bullet jump, bit not near as much as the 45 colt in a 410 chamber. At 50 yards you should be able to shoot a 4-6" group, maybe tighter if you're a good shot, and seat your bullets out as far as you can get away with. It'd make a good rat gun at the dump, or in the barn, maybe even take a rabbit pretty close. Good if your in a snake area.
